A car accelerates uniformly from rest and reaches a speed of 22.1 m/s in 8.97 s.

(a) If the diameter of a tire is 57.5 cm, find the number of revolutions the tire makes during this motion, assuming that no slipping occurs.

(b) What is the final angular speed of a tire in revolutions per second?
